Partager via


MonitorDefinition Classe

Définition

The MonitorDefinition.

public class MonitorDefinition
type MonitorDefinition = class
Public Class MonitorDefinition
Héritage
MonitorDefinition

Constructeurs

MonitorDefinition(MonitorComputeConfigurationBase, IDictionary<String,MonitoringSignalBase>)

Initialise une nouvelle instance de MonitorDefinition.

Propriétés

AlertNotificationSetting

Paramètres de notification du moniteur. Veuillez noter qu’il MonitoringAlertNotificationSettingsBase s’agit de la classe de base. Selon le scénario, une classe dérivée de la classe de base peut devoir être affectée ici, ou cette propriété doit être castée en une des classes dérivées possibles. Les classes dérivées disponibles incluent AzMonMonitoringAlertNotificationSettings et EmailMonitoringAlertNotificationSettings.

ComputeConfiguration

[Obligatoire] ID de ressource ARM de la ressource de calcul sur laquelle exécuter le travail de supervision. Veuillez noter qu’il MonitorComputeConfigurationBase s’agit de la classe de base. Selon le scénario, une classe dérivée de la classe de base peut devoir être affectée ici, ou cette propriété doit être castée en une des classes dérivées possibles. Les classes dérivées disponibles incluent MonitorServerlessSparkCompute.

MonitoringTarget

ID de ressource ARM du modèle ou du déploiement ciblé par ce moniteur.

Signals

[Obligatoire] Signaux à surveiller. Veuillez noter qu’il MonitoringSignalBase s’agit de la classe de base. Selon le scénario, une classe dérivée de la classe de base peut devoir être affectée ici, ou cette propriété doit être castée en une des classes dérivées possibles. Les classes dérivées disponibles incluent , , FeatureAttributionDriftMonitoringSignal, , GenerationSafetyQualityMonitoringSignal, GenerationTokenStatisticsSignalet PredictionDriftMonitoringSignalModelPerformanceSignal . DataQualityMonitoringSignalDataDriftMonitoringSignalCustomMonitoringSignal

S’applique à